About this commercial property

45 Nettlefold Street in Belconnen, ACT, occupies a 1,582 m² land parcel and is presently tenanted by Neutral Grounds, operating as a café. The property offers direct street access and on‑site parking spaces that accommodate both customer and staff vehicles, supporting the operational requirements of a food‑service business. Its sizable site provides flexibility for signage, outdoor seating or future layout modifications.

How is the property positioned relative to major commercial hubs in Belconnen?

It is located less than 1 km from Westfield Belconnen and the Belconnen Town Centre, placing the café within a high‑traffic commercial precinct.

What transport options are available for customers and staff accessing the site?

The property benefits from several bus stations in the nearby town centre and is surrounded by major arterial roads, including Ginninderra Drive, Aikman Drive, Eastern Valley Way, Belconnen Way and Coulter Drive, providing convenient public‑transport and vehicle access.

Which nearby amenities could help drive foot traffic to a café at this address?

Nearby attractions such as Hoyts cinema, Ramada Encore and Mercure hotels, the CSIRO Marine and Atmospheric Research facility, and the National Health Co‑op generate steady visitor flow that can complement a café’s customer base.

Are there government or corporate offices close to the property that could provide additional clientele?

Within about 0.7 km are major government offices, including the Australian Bureau of Statistics and the Department of Home Affairs immigration division, offering a potential clientele of employees and visitors.
